What will you learn?
Finance is ultimately about making optimal and strategic decisions in an uncertain environment, which applies to all areas of business. A modern manager requires insight into the drivers of the financial situation of an enterprise, which is intimately connected with its success. This major combination will provide you not only with the required education for management positions in a broad range of industries, but also a strong basis for a career within finance and consulting.
